How Colonist.io Handles Reports of Toxic Behavior

We want Colonist.io to be a safe and friendly place for everyone. If you encounter toxic behavior in a game, you can report it directly through the in-game reporting tools.

What Happens When You Submit a Report?

1
Report Submission
You report a player for toxic behavior using the in-game reporting feature.
2
Review by Moderators
A Colonist.io moderator reviews the report, the in-game chat, and any other available evidence from the match.
3
Assessment of Behavior
The moderator determines whether the reported behavior violates community guidelines or terms of service.
4
Decision and Action
If necessary, the moderator will issue appropriate actions, which may include warnings, temporary restrictions, or other measures to keep the community safe.
5
Player Notification (if applicable)

We may notify players about what action was taken.

What Actions Can Be Taken?

  • Warnings for first or minor offenses

  • Temporary chat or account restrictions

  • Permanent bans for repeated or severe violations

These actions are meant to encourage good behavior and keep players safe.
